Data Logger

Sonardyne’s latest generation of subsea Data Logger Units combines a digital wideband acoustic data link with a package that is ROV-portable. The unit is suitable for either long or short term deployment, being constructed from super duplex steel and the wideband acoustic link enables data files to be uploaded much more quickly than was previously possible.

The package is rated to a depth of 3,000m and has an approximate weight in air of 70kg, reducing to 50kg in water. The data logger has been designed for ease of ROV deployment and tree mounting. A 4-way r 7 way Tronic connector on the side of the data logger may be ROV-mateable or may be connected to a jumper cable prior to deployment. Alternative connectors can be provided at customers’ request.

The Data Logger Unit is capable of interfacing to down hole gauges from all of the major suppliers such as: Schlumberger, Roxar, Well Dynamics, etc. Other manufacturers’ gauges can also be interfaced as required. Several interfacing options exist: • A gauge manufacturer’s single Eurocard, such as those supplied for use in a SEM, can be accommodated within the logger. • The logger can supply power and communicate with a gauge manufacturer’s card located within a separate pod. • Sonardyne can provide a purpose designed interface card, fully integrated with the logging electronic circuits.

The Data Logger Unit is normally fitted with one 4-way or 7 way Tronic connector for connection to gauges or external gauge interfaces.

Logging life is essentially dominated by the battery power consumed by the gauges and interface circuitry each time a measurement is made. Using a standard battery, the life will typically be greater than 2 years if gauges are read only a few times per day but may reduce to a few weeks if gauges are read every few minutes. A double size battery pack in an extended housing is available as an option. Sonardyne can advise on the approximate battery life for any given logging rate according to clients’ individual applications.

Logging intervals can be varied by acoustic command from 1 minute to 7 days. Memory capacity is 256Mbytes. In general, the battery life is a greater constraint than memory size.

 
Specifications
FeatureType 8057
Depth Rating 3,000 metres
Operating Frequency LF (14–19kHz)
Transducer Beamshape ±90º (Shallow)
±30º (Deep)
Transmit Source Level (dB re 1µPa @ 1m) 192dB (Shallow)
202dB (Deep)
Receiver Threshold(dB re 1µPa)
Power Long Life Lithium
Typical Battery Life (assuming 3 gauges) at a reading rate of: 
1 reading every 10 minutes 
1 reading every hour 
1 reading every day

230 days
2.5 years
5 years

Acoustic Data Link High Speed, Sonardyne Wideband
Acoustic Data Transmission Rate 600 Baud (True payload rate- raw data rate is 1200 Baud)
Data Storage Capacity 8Mb Standard (Expandable to 16Mb)
External Interfaces:
Analogue or 
Serial

1x Gauge vF
1x Serial Port
External connectors ROV Mateable
Battery Storage 14.5 V
ROV Transportable Yes
Mechanical Construction Super Duplex Stainless Steel
Weight in Air 70kg
Weight in Water 50kg
Note 1. The standard 8Mb capacity represents more than 3 years of data storage, at one reading (of 3 gauges) every 10 minutes. For virtually all practical applications, there will be substantial memory capacity left unused at the end of the deployment, as the memory usage life will typically exceed the life of the internal battery pack.
